How to Make Phoenix Tears: A Comprehensive Guide
Phoenix Tears, also known as Rick Simpson Oil (RSO), is a concentrated form of cannabis oil that has gained significant popularity in recent years due to its potential therapeutic benefits. Its high potency makes it an effective treatment option for various ailments, including cancer, chronic pain, and epilepsy. In this article, we will guide you through the process of making Phoenix Tears at home, providing step-by-step instructions and addressing some frequently asked questions.
Ingredients and Equipment:
1. High-quality cannabis flowers (preferably indica strains)
2. Ethanol (99% isopropyl alcohol can be used as an alternative)
3. A rice cooker or double boiler
4. A stainless-steel mixing bowl
5. A wooden spoon
6. Cheesecloth or a fine-mesh sieve
7. A syringe or dropper bottle for storage
Step-by-step Guide:
1. Decarboxylation: Preheat your oven to 240°F (115°C). Grind the cannabis flowers and spread them evenly on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Bake the cannabis in the oven for 40-60 minutes to activate the cannabinoids. This step is crucial as it enhances the potency of the final product.
2. Extraction: Place the decarboxylated cannabis into a stainless-steel mixing bowl. Pour enough ethanol to fully submerge the plant material. Gently stir the mixture for about three minutes, ensuring that all the cannabinoids dissolve into the solvent. This process extracts the valuable compounds from the cannabis.
3. Straining: Carefully strain the mixture through cheesecloth or a fine-mesh sieve into another bowl or container. This step separates the liquid solvent from the plant material, leaving you with a potent cannabis extract.
4. Evaporation: Transfer the extracted liquid into a rice cooker or double boiler. Ensure that you are in a well-ventilated area, as the evaporation process can release flammable fumes. Heat the mixture gently until the solvent begins to evaporate. Continue heating until only a thick, dark oil remains in the cooker. Be cautious to avoid overheating, as it can degrade the cannabinoids.
5. Cooling and Storage: Let the oil cool for a few minutes, then transfer it to a syringe or dropper bottle for easy dosing and storage. Ensure that the container is airtight and kept in a cool, dark place to maintain its potency.
Frequently Asked Questions:
1. Is it legal to make Phoenix Tears at home?
The legality of making Phoenix Tears varies from country to country and state to state. Before proceeding, it is essential to research and understand the laws governing cannabis and its derivatives in your jurisdiction.
2. Can any cannabis strain be used to make Phoenix Tears?
While any cannabis strain can be used, it is generally recommended to use indica strains for their higher levels of CBD and THC, which contribute to the medicinal properties of Phoenix Tears.
3. What is the recommended dosage of Phoenix Tears?
The dosage of Phoenix Tears depends on various factors, including the individual’s condition, tolerance, and the concentration of the oil. It is advisable to start with a low dose and gradually increase it until the desired effects are achieved. Consulting a healthcare professional experienced in cannabis therapeutics is highly recommended.
4. Are there any side effects of using Phoenix Tears?
Common side effects may include drowsiness, dry mouth, and increased appetite. However, individuals may react differently, so it is crucial to monitor your body’s response and adjust the dosage accordingly.
5. How should Phoenix Tears be consumed?
Phoenix Tears can be consumed orally by placing a small amount under the tongue or mixing it with food and beverages. It can also be applied topically for localized pain relief.
6. How long does it take for Phoenix Tears to take effect?
The onset time and duration of Phoenix Tears vary from person to person. It typically takes around 30 minutes to 2 hours to experience the effects, which can last up to 6-8 hours.
7. Can Phoenix Tears be used by everyone?
While Phoenix Tears are generally safe, it is important to consult a healthcare professional, especially if you have any pre-existing health conditions or are taking other medications. Pregnant or breastfeeding individuals should avoid using cannabis products.
